Cambridge-Isanti High School has a long and rich tradition of athletic competition and fine arts accomplishments. The purpose of this Hall of Fame is to recognize the career accomplishments of our Bluejacket alumni. The first induction ceremony will take place on August 20, 2017. The banquet will be at the Spirit River Community Center in Isanti at 6 p.m., with social hour beginning at 5 p.m.
The Bluejacket Hall of Fame Committee is excited to announce the inaugural class. The individuals being inducted into the Bluejacket Hall of Fame as its first class are: George Larson (football) • Jerry Carlson (football) • Jack Peterson (basketball) • Bill Smrekar (boys hockey) • Lois Tureen (track & field) • Deb Hegquist (gymnastics).
• The Hall of Fame will also recognize the 1978 Class AA State Softball Championship team.

C-I’s Peterson also in MSHSCA Hall
The Minnesota State High School Coaches Association honored its Hall of Fame selections for 2016 at an Oct. 8 banquet in Minnetonka. The seven inductees included Bluejacket boys basketball coach John “Jack” Peterson.
Peterson started his coaching career in Arkansas, Wisc. before moving on to other schools. In 1966, Jack moved to Cambridge High School where he coached basketball. During a 17-year stretch, he accumulated 243 wins and during one 10-year stretch his Bluejackets amassed 191 wins to only 51 losses.
Long-time C-I rival coach Ron Stolski of Princeton and Brainerd football was another inductee at the banquet.
